In Jay Leno’s Garage: Ford Police Interceptors

December 22, 2010 by  
Filed under Automotive, Ford, Video

Jay Leno gets to talk with Gerry Koss, Ford’s Marketing Manager for Fleet Operations. They introduce the two new Police Interceptors which Ford has been working with advisory board to create vehicles with three key points: reliability, safety and durability. The new Ford Taurus and Ford Explorer Interceptors provide many options for outfitting based on a police unit needs. With over 365 horsepower, the new Interceptor vehicles can keep up with anything a criminal can throw at them.
